Impulse modulating beam double tetrode for use in fixed and mobile radio equipment. Case type: glass, baseless. Mass 70 g
Main parameters (at Uf=12.6 V, Ua=1000 V, Ug2=700 V, U’g1=U’’g1=-150 V, U’g1.imp=-100 V, Ia=200 mA, τ=1µs, pulse ratio 1000)
| Filament current, A | 1.1±1 | 
| 1st grid reverse current, µA | ≤3 | 
| 2nd grid impulse current, A | ≤3 | 
| Anode impulse current, A | ≥8.0 | 
| Anode impulse current (at Uf=11.4 V), A | ≥7.5 | 
| Grid-to-filament leakage current, µA | ≤100 | 
| 1st grid cut-off voltage (negative, at Ua=4000 V, Ug1=800 V, Ia=0.2 A), V | 125-55 | 
| Interelectrode capacitance, pF input output input-to-output | 14.5±3.5 5.2±1 ≤0.2 | 
| Durability, h | ≥600 | 
| Durability test anode impulse current (at Uf=11.4 V), A anode impulse current, A | ≥5 ≥7 | 
Operational limits
| Filament voltage in series mode, V | 11.4-14 | 
| Filament voltage in parallel mode, V | 5.7-7 | 
| Anode voltage, V | 4000 | 
| 2nd grid voltage, V | 800 | 
| 1st grid voltage, V | 200 | 
| 1st grid impulse voltage, V | 150 | 
| Cathode-to-filament voltage, V | 150 | 
| Cathode-to-filament negative voltage, V | 150 | 
| Cathode impulse current, A | 15 | 
| Anode power dissipation, W | 15 | 
| 2nd grid power dissipation, W | 3 | 
| 1st grid power dissipation, W | 1 | 
| Impulse duration, µs | 5 | 
| Envelope temperature, oC | 260 | 
| Ambient air temperature, oC | -60..+90 |
